Output 6caf95ee79bbc4b7fc8e0e566b10e4074018e65ccc4c7be86ab5bea48f47831a:1

value
3690060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 548634456b93e6ecc4ab982a8bfd38f4c55b201d OP_EQUAL
address
39PwTKxejdoTBV4Kj5wcSA9e664zGxonsT
transaction
6caf95ee79bbc4b7fc8e0e566b10e4074018e65ccc4c7be86ab5bea48f47831a
spent
true